Mitragynine

AlkaPlorer ID: AK004936

Synonym: '', 'Speciogynine', 'Mitragynine', 'Speciogynin', 'Speciociliatine', 'Speciociliatin'

IUPAC Name: methyl (E)-2-[(2S,3S,12bR)-3-ethyl-8-methoxy-1,2,3,4,6,7,12,12b-octahydroindolo[2,3-a]quinolizin-2-yl]-3-methoxyprop-2-enoate

Structure

SMILES: CC[C@@H]1CN2CCC3=C(NC4=C3C(OC)=CC=C4)[C@H]2C[C@@H]1/C(=C\OC)C(=O)OC

copy

InChI: InChI=1S/C23H30N2O4/c1-5-14-12-25-10-9-15-21-18(7-6-8-20(21)28-3)24-22(15)19(25)11-16(14)17(13-27-2)23(26)29-4/h6-8,13-14,16,19,24H,5,9-12H2,1-4H3/b17-13+/t14-,16+,19-/m1/s1

copy

InChIKey: LELBFTMXCIIKKX-MYLQJJOTSA-N

copy

Properties Information

Molecule Weight: 398.5030000000002

TPSA: 63.790000000000006

MolLogP: 3.8251000000000026

Number of H-Donors: 1

Number of H-Acceptors: 5

RingCount: 4
